Epitope
ab11232 recognises the alpha 4 epitope of the alpha-subunit of Human Chorionic Gonadotrophin (hCG), hLH, hFSH, hTSH and free alpha-subunit. -

Sequence similarities
Belongs to the glycoprotein hormones subunit alpha family. -
Cellular localization
Secreted. - Information by UniProt
